Core Viewpoint - The opening of Suzhou "Wanti Hui" marks the first cross-regional sports complex operated by Jiushi Sports, integrating sports and lifestyle in Suzhou High-speed Rail New City [3][5] Group 1: Project Overview - Suzhou "Wanti Hui" is located in the southern core area of Suzhou High-speed Rail New City, seamlessly connected to Metro Line 2 [3] - The complex features various sports facilities, including the first indoor standard red clay tennis court in Suzhou, a large gym, a standard swimming pool with 21×50 meters and eight lanes, as well as badminton, table tennis, basketball, outdoor soccer, climbing, and pickleball areas [3] Group 2: Services and Operations - The venue aims to provide a one-stop sports and integrated consumption experience, with additional services such as a convenience service center, a branch of Suzhou Library, and a fresh market [3] - Jiushi Sports plans to leverage its event operation experience to host more spectator and participatory events, enhancing the city's sports vitality [5] Group 3: Strategic Alignment - The establishment of Suzhou "Wanti Hui" aligns with the national strategy to promote high-quality development in the sports industry, responding quickly to the government's call for regional sports industry development [5] - The integration of Shanghai's operational experience with Suzhou's industrial foundation and market potential is expected to optimize local sports service supply and promote resource sharing in the Yangtze River Delta [5][7] Group 4: Future Prospects - The venue is positioned to facilitate business collaboration, hosting corporate team-building, industry events, and brand promotions, thereby enhancing regional sports consumption [5] - The 30-minute high-speed rail commuting advantage between Shanghai and Suzhou will support business synergy and service interconnectivity, creating a sustainable sports service ecosystem [7]
